Output 51ff239051019eb5d8ef11ccde79e4630168b35cedee9c6db860c9e3f6c9763f:0

value
51861500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c8600cc22381fd7b40d833d429a9564bd7594a4 OP_EQUAL
address
MEsn7i59XhnWUfPDhPXpmKEsix9awdEuvj
transaction
51ff239051019eb5d8ef11ccde79e4630168b35cedee9c6db860c9e3f6c9763f
spent
true